Delhi AI Summit Expected to Adopt 'Delhi Declaration'
An upcoming AI summit in Delhi is anticipated to conclude with the adoption of a 'Delhi declaration,' likely outlining principles or policies related to artificial intelligence.

Feb 16–20: Traffic curbs in Delhi for AI Summit could slow your commute; TOI helps you plan
Delhi commuters face significant traffic disruptions from February 16-20 due to the AI Impact Summit at Pragati Maidan. Expect stricter rules, diversions, and potential road closures, especially during VVIP movements. Plan for extra travel time, utilize the main north-south Ring Road corridor, and consider the Metro for smoother journeys.
